Arnold & Porter Adds Counsel to D.C. Office

Marc Daniel has joined Arnold & Porter as counsel in the firm’s Washington D.C. office. He will join recent additions John Busillo and Alan Lawrence in the firm’s real estate, bankruptcy and corporate practices.

“Marc has a wealth of experience in originating, selling, and restructuring commercial real estate debt. The turmoil in the capital markets over the past few years is creating additional demand for this expertise,” said Michael Goodwin, head of Arnold & Porter’s real estate practice, said in a press release.

Daniel’s experience includes mortgage and mezzanine financings, workouts and restructurings, along with sales and purchases of mortgage, mezzanine and other real estate-related debt involving a variety of structures and property types.

Arnold & Porter’s real estate practice includes 30 lawyers practicing in New York Washington D.C., Los Angeles and London. The international law firm has more than 675 lawyers with offices in Brussels, Denver, London, Los Angeles, New York, Northern Virginia, San Francisco and Washington D.C.
